NAF AIR STRIKES NEUTRALIZE DOZENS OF TERRORISTS IN MARTE, DECIMATE KEY SUPPLY DEPOTS
The Nigerian Air Force (NAF) executed a series of successful air interdictions targeting 3 significant enclaves of Islamic State West Africa Province (ISWAP) terrorists in Marte Local Government Area on 31 October 2024. The precision strikes focused on known ISWAP strongholds in the villages of Tumbun Daribiyar, Jubularam, Buluwa, and Tumbu Karfe, marking a major effort in the ongoing fight against terrorism in Nigeria’s Northeast. The attention of the Nigerian Air Force (NAF) has been drawn to a video circulating on social and other media, depicting an altercation between some NAF personnel and police officers in Warri, Delta State, on Tuesday, 11 February 2025. The NAF wishes to state that the incident has been decisively addressed. The Commander of the concerned NAF unit has engaged with the relevant Police authorities in Delta State to resolve the matter with a view to enhancing inter-agency understanding. Read MoreNAF ENGINEERS DEMONSTRATE EXCEPTIONAL EXPERTISE BY REVIVING AIRCRAFT GROUNDED FOR 23 YEARS
In a phenomenal display of engineering ingenuity, aircraft engineers and technicians of the Nigerian Air Force (NAF) have accomplished the remarkable feat of reactivating a Dornier DO-228 aircraft, which had been grounded for 23 years.
